公众号功能设置:业务域名、JS接口安全域名、网页授权域名 分别有什么用?
本文摘要
微信公众号开发中,业务域名、JS接口安全域名和网页授权域名是三个重要的设置项,可以帮助公众号进行一些重要的业务操作和安全校验。灵魂拷问:绑定父级域名,是否其子域名也是可用的(是的,合法的子域名在绑定父域...
微信公众号的业务域名、JS接口安全域名和网页授权域名是三个核心配置项,各自承担不同的功能和安全验证机制。以下是它们的区别及关键要点,可以帮助公众号进行一些重要的业务操作和安全校验。
灵魂拷问:绑定父级域名,是否其子域名也是可用的(是的,合法的子域名在绑定父域名之后是完全支持的)
1、业务域名是指公众号的主要运营网站域名,用于标识公众号的官方网页,避免用户访问钓鱼网站。用于在微信浏览器中打开公众号网页并执行业务操作,如分享、支付等。设置业务域名后,用户就可以使用微信来访问到公众号网站,而不用再跳转到其他浏览器中。不支持子域名自动覆盖,需单独配置(如 a.example.com
需独立添加)。划重点:影响分享
2、JS接口安全域名主要用于安全校验,控制哪些域名可调用微信JS-SDK(如分享、支付、定位等前端功能)。在公众号中使用JS-SDK时,需要绑定域名进行校验,以确保JS-SDK的正常使用,同时防止恶意攻击行为。因此设置JS接口安全域名是很重要的。支持子域名自动继承(如配置 example.com
,则 a.example.com
也生效),需要前端交互的网页(如自定义分享、扫码支付)。
划重点:影响开发
3、网页授权域名主要针对公众号实现网页授权功能,用于OAuth2.0授权流程,获取用户基本信息(如OpenID、昵称)。实现用户网页授权登录、获取用户基本信息等操作。这个设置项可以提升公众号的用户体验度。数量限制:仅支持1个主域名,但包含其所有子域名(如配置 example.com
,则 a.example.com
也生效)
划重点:影响PC网页登录
最后记得要添加白名单:
相关文章






****更多行业产品开发方案,请关注 加速度JSUDO***
<以上资讯仅供参考,如果您需解决具体问题,建议您关注作者;如果有软件产品开发需求,可在线咨询加速度产品经理获取方案和报价>
加速度JSUDO是一家专注于为企/事业单位的供应链提供数字化营销/服务的公司。产品线涵盖线上营销策划、商城开发、智慧园区、智能客服和企微SCRM系统等,应用于营销推广-线上交易-销售管理-物流配送和服务支持等,致力于帮助企业开发更具投资价值的“数字”资产产品。
